Understanding Door Hinge Alignment: Importance, Methods, and FAQs
Door hinge alignment is an important yet typically neglected element of home maintenance. Correctly lined up door hinges not just offer performance however likewise enhance the visual appeals and security of a home. Misaligned hinges can cause a variety of issues, from doors that do not close correctly to increased wear and tear on the door frame, affecting both durability and efficiency. This short article dives into the significance of door hinge alignment, approaches for alignment, typical issues associated with misalignment, and responses to frequently asked questions.
Importance of Door Hinge Alignment
Proper hinge alignment is vital for a number of factors:
Functionality: A lined up hinge enables a door to open and close smoothly without jamming or sticking.Security: Misalignment can produce spaces, making it easier for trespassers to access your home.Aesthetic appeals: Well-aligned doors contribute to a refined, properly maintained appearance in your home.Sturdiness: Proper alignment lowers wear on both the door and the frame, extending their lifespan.Comfort: A door that closes totally makes sure personal privacy and temperature control within your home.Causes of Misalignment
Misalignment can take place due to several elements:
Worn out hinges: Over time, hinges can wear down, triggering the door to sag.Temperature changes: Changes in humidity and temperature level can warp wooden doors and frames, leading to alignment issues.Improper installation: If hinges are not installed correctly, alignment can be compromised from the outset.Heavy usage: Frequent use can intensify endure hinges, specifically if the door is heavy.Techniques to Align Door Hinges
Aligning door hinges can frequently be an uncomplicated DIY task. Below are techniques that can be used to deal with misalignment:
1. Tightening Screws
Often, an easy tightening up of the hinge screws can fix small misalignments.
Collect required tools: screwdriver and a level.Tighten screws on all hinge plates while making sure the door hinge repair service is not under pressure from the frame.2. Adjusting the Hinge Position
For more severe cases of misalignment, changing the position of the hinges might be needed.
Eliminate the door: Unscrew the hinges from the frame and the door. Deal with the door carefully to avoid damage.Edit hinge placement: You might desire to reposition hinges somewhat. Utilize shims, washers, or move the hinge holes slightly to make sure appropriate alignment.Re-install the door: Once the hinges are changed, re-hang the door thoroughly and look for correct alignment.3. Adding Shims
Shimming can assist adjust the door's position without significant structural modifications.
Determine the gap: Open and close the door to spot where the alignment problem lies.Insert shims: Place thin pieces of wood or cardboard behind the hinge plates on the door or frame as essential.4. Replacing Hinges
If hinges are substantially used out, changing them may be the very best option.
Select a suitable hinge based upon door weight and style.Follow installation instructions thoroughly, making sure precise alignment during placement.5. Expert Help
In complicated cases or when unsure, it might be best to hire professionals who can align your door correctly.

How can I tell if my door hinges are misaligned?
Common signs include problem opening or closing the door, unequal spaces, or visible discrepancies in how the door fits within the frame.
Can I fix misaligned door hinge professional hinges myself?
Yes, numerous misalignment issues can be resolved through simple changes. Nevertheless, for extreme problems, consider employing an expert door hinge repairman.
What tools will I need for hinge alignment?
A screwdriver, a level, and possibly shims or replacement hinges will generally be needed. Depending on the extent of the misalignment, additional tools might be needed.
What kinds of doors are most susceptible to hinge misalignment?
Heavier doors-- such as strong wood or metal doors-- are typically more vulnerable to misalignment due to the weight placed on the hinges over time.
How frequently should I check my door hinges?
It is advisable to examine hinges at least as soon as a year, specifically if the door experiences frequent use or if your home is subject to severe temperature modifications.
